PASEO NUEVO URGENT CARE PLLC is an AHC clinic located in EL PASO, TX. NPPES has assigned the NPI number 1619596566 to PASEO NUEVO URGENT CARE PLLC on April 10, 2020. It is a Type-2 NPI, indicating this NPI number is associated with an organization. The primary taxonomy selected by this provider is 261QU0200X from the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set, which is classified as Clinic/Center, specializing in Urgent Care

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
